Longitudinal myelitis in systemic lupus erythematosus: a paediatric case
Rheumatology International
|July 28, 2011
Summary
Acute transverse myelitis (ATM) is a rare central nervous system complication of systemic lupus erythematosus (SLE). This case highlights a severe longitudinal spinal cord involvement in a pediatric patient, resulting in poor outcomes despite aggressive treatment.

Background:
- Systemic lupus erythematosus (SLE) is a complex autoimmune disease with diverse neurological manifestations.
- Acute transverse myelitis (ATM) is an uncommon but severe central nervous system (CNS) complication of SLE.
Observation:
- A 12-year-old female presented with acute transverse myelitis (ATM) at the onset of systemic lupus erythematosus (SLE).
- The myelitis demonstrated extensive longitudinal involvement of the spinal cord, spanning from D2 to D10 segments.
Findings:
- Despite early and aggressive therapeutic interventions, the patient experienced an unfavorable outcome.
- Two years post-diagnosis, the patient continues to suffer from paraplegia, sphincter incontinence, and hypo-paresthesias in both lower extremities.
Implications:
- This case underscores the potential for severe and debilitating CNS involvement in pediatric SLE.
- It highlights the challenges in managing longitudinal myelitis associated with SLE, even with prompt and aggressive treatment.
- Further research into optimal therapeutic strategies for CNS lupus, particularly myelitis, is warranted.
